Less than $15

Aug. 16, 2010 BODEGA RUCA MALEN Chardonnay Mendoza Yauquén 2009 (85 points, $12)

Plump and friendly, featuring creamed apple and pear flavors backed by a medium-weight, buttery edge. Drink now. 5,000 cases made. —James Molesworth


$15 to $30

Aug. 16, 2010 BODEGAS VALDEMAR Tempranillo Rioja Conde de Valdemar Crianza 2006 (87 points, $15)

Pretty berry and cherry flavors are accented by vanilla, spice and smoke in this lithe, graceful red. Bright acidity keeps this lively. Drink now through 2012. 40,000 cases made. —Thomas Matthews


More than $30

Aug. 16, 2010 DELAS Châteauneuf-du-Pape Haute Pierre 2008 (91 points, $46)

This has nice polish for the vintage, with racy blueberry, raspberry and boysenberry fruit flavors well-supported by graphite, fruitcake and licorice root. A spicy edge lingers nicely on the fleshy finish. Drink now through 2025. 2,500 cases made. —James Molesworth
